Chapter 2: The Name That Changed Everything

— PART 2 —

Cameron didn't back down.

That was his first mistake.

"I don't know who you are," he said, his voice still smooth, still performing for the room.

"But she's mine.

And I'm taking her home."

No one moved.

No one spoke.

The stranger looked at Cameron the way a man looks at something small that has wandered somewhere it doesn't belong.

"She said no." His voice was quiet.

Almost gentle.

"That's the only answer that matters here."

Cameron's jaw tightened.

"You don't understand the situation."

"I understand it perfectly."

Nora felt the arm around her waist — not gripping, not forcing.

Just there.

A wall between her and the man who had made her afraid for two years.

Cameron took one more step forward.

"Nora.

Don't make this worse."

She felt her hands shake.

But she didn't move.

Then one of the stranger's men leaned down and said something quietly into his ear.

The stranger's expression didn't change.

But something shifted behind his eyes.

He looked at Nora differently now.

Like he had just heard something about her that she hadn't told him yet.

"What's your name?" he asked softly.

"Nora.

Nora Bennett."

A long pause.

"Bennett," he repeated.

Almost to himself.

And for the first time that night, it was the stranger who went very still.
